Unraveling the Unknown: Overcoming Urbanization Challenges through Sustainable City Planning

Cityscape

Urbanization is an inevitable global trend, with more and more people flocking to cities in search of better opportunities and quality of life. While urban areas offer promise, they also present a myriad of challenges, from congestion and pollution to overutilization of resources. To tackle these issues head-on, cities worldwide are turning to sustainable city planning as a beacon of hope for a greener, more efficient future.


Embracing Sustainable City Planning for a Brighter Tomorrow



City Planning

Sustainable city planning revolves around creating urban environments that prioritize environmental, social, and economic sustainability. By weaving together green spaces, efficient public transportation, renewable energy sources, and smart use of resources, city planners can pave the way for a harmonious coexistence between humans and the environment. This holistic approach not only enhances the quality of life for urban dwellers but also preserves the planet for future generations.


Challenges on the Road to Sustainable Urbanization



Urban Challenges

While the concept of sustainable city planning is undoubtedly promising, it is not without its challenges. One of the primary hurdles is retrofitting existing urban infrastructure to align with sustainable principles. From upgrading transportation systems to retrofitting buildings for energy efficiency, the transition to sustainability requires a significant investment of resources and a fundamental shift in urban planning paradigms.


Navigating the Urban Landscape: Solutions and Innovations


In the quest for sustainable urbanization, innovative solutions are emerging to address the challenges faced by modern cities. Smart technologies, such as IoT sensors and data analytics, are revolutionizing urban management by optimizing resource allocation and enhancing connectivity. Additionally, collaborative urban planning efforts that engage citizens in decision-making processes are proving to be effective in creating livable, inclusive communities.
